Lola And Sean Stay On Top After Sleepover Twist
UK betting sites have kept Lola Deal and Sean Fitzgerald at the top of their respective Love Island markets, with William Hill making them 9/4 and 5/2 favourites for Top Female and Top Male respectively.
The best entertainment betting sites have responded to a dramatic week in the villa, including a new sleepover-villa, the introduction of four new bombshells, and a wobble between Mica and Simba that has implications well beyond their own coupling.
The favourite couple are also at the centre of the romantic narrative this week, with Lola and Sean admitting they've fallen in love after just two weeks together.
That's the kind of bombshell-free emotional momentum that traditionally drives Love Island markets, and the layers have responded by keeping both names at the front of their respective books.

Lola Deal at 9/4 has held favouritism throughout the early part of the series, and her "in love" moment with Sean this week has likely cemented that.
A 30.8% implied probability reflects her status as the most consistently strong female narrative in the villa, with her coupling stable, her screen time prominent, and her overall trajectory positive.
Ellie Chadwick at 4/1 is the biggest mover. She's shortened significantly from the earlier-series prices and now sits as the clear second favourite. Her arc has been one of the more compelling storylines, and at a 20% implied probability the layers are essentially calling her the chief threat to Lola.
Mica Harris at 8/1 is the most interesting price on the board right now. Her hesitation about Simba after their sleepover closeness means her coupling situation is in genuine flux.

Sean Fitzgerald at 5/2 has held favouritism on the strength of his coupling with Lola, and the romantic-momentum boost from this week's love declaration should keep that position firm. A 28.6% implied probability is the bookies betting on the favourite couple staying intact through to the final.
Finley Maddock at 7/1 is the standout new bombshell entry. As one of the four sleepover-villa newcomers, he's been priced as a genuine threat from his first appearance.
The Sleepover Villa Effect
Last night's episode saw Halle, Chidi, Tina and Finley return to the main villa after their sleepover, having brought Mica, Simba, Yasmin and Kavan over to join them.
That's a recipe for exactly the kind of mid-series upheaval that Love Island producers love and Love Island markets respond to dramatically.
The key thing for backers to watch over the coming days is whether any of those eight Islanders make recoupling decisions that disrupt the dominant favourite couple structure.
If Lola and Sean continue to look stable, the men's and women's markets behind them stay relatively orderly. If anyone defects from a settled coupling, expect significant price movement across the board.
